Behold, a collaboration between Alfa Romeo and Japan’s best known traditional art since the Edo Period, and the Great Wave off Kanagawa. The big surge of waves swallows the boat with no mercy in mind.

You can see the Fuji mountain from the side, the Great Wave off Kanagawa is one of the most imporant series of "36 views of Mt.Fuji."

This masterpiece was all done by pure hand painting, and was named “Alfa Romeo 4C Hokusai.” Besides the wavy blue looking from the outside, the interior was also carefully crafted with denim material, a different leather as well as a different atmosphere.
